In calatoria sa de a oferi rezultate organice mai bune si experiente centrate pe utilizator, Google a anuntat un nou factor de ranking (clasare) a rezultatelor organice, care influeneaza masiv SEO: The Core Web Vitals.
Ce reprezinta Core Web Vitals?
Core Web Vitals este un set de metrici esentiale introduse de Google pentru a evalua si imbunatati experienta utilizatorilor pe site-uri web. Incepand cu 2021, acesti indicatori au devenit un factor cheie in evaluarea performantei unui site din punct de vedere al vitezei, interactiunii si stabilitatii vizuale, avand un impact direct asupra clasamentului in motoarele de cautare.
Scopul principal al Core Web Vitals este de a oferi o masuratoare clara asupra experientei utilizatorilor in timpul navigarii pe un site. Google isi propune sa ofere utilizatorilor o experienta de navigare cat mai rapida si confortabila, iar prin intermediul acestor metrici, isi poate ajusta algoritmul de cautare pentru a promova site-urile care indeplinesc criteriile de performanta. Practic, Core Web Vitals ajuta dezvoltatorii si proprietarii de site-uri sa imbunatateasca timpii de incarcare si interactiunile pe pagina, ceea ce va contribui la o experienta generala mai buna.
Core Web Vitals este un update semnificativ anuntat de Google pentru implementare din Mai 2021 care va masura experienta reala a utilizatorilor unui site. Core Web Vitals este axat pe trei semnale principale:
- Largest Contentful Paint (LCP) – cea mai mare bucata de continut din fiecare pagina a unui site
- First Input Delay (FID) – viteza de interactivitate / interactiune a unui utilizator cu site-ul
- Cumulative Layout Shift (CLS) – stabilitatea vizuala a site-ului
Pentru toate aceste 3 metrice, Google a oferit si niste valori la care ne putem raporta:
Acum, haide sa le explicam putin pe fiecare in parte.
LCP (largest contentful paint) – masoara viteza de incarcare a celei mai mari bucati de continut dintr-o pagina a unui site.
Acea bucata de continut poate fi:
- un cod html, o imagine, un fisier CSS sau Javascript, etc.
Conform Google, un scor bun pentru LCP este de pana in 2.5 secunde.
Intre 2.5 secunde si 4.0 secunde, Google va considera ca site-ul sau pagina analizata necesita imbunatatiri.
Pentru a fi mai precis, LCP masoara viteza de incarcare perceputa, adica cat dureaza pana cand o pagina afiseaza primele elemente importante pentru utilizator.
Aceasta metrica nu masoara viteza de incarcare completa a paginii.
FID (first input delay) – masoara „capacitatea de reactie” a unei pagini.
Mai exact, algoritmii Google se vor uita la timpul dintre momentul in care un utilizator interactioneaza pentru prima data cu o pagina (cand face click pe un link sau buton) si momentul in care browserul este in masura sa raspunda la acea interactiune.
Google Core Web Vitals pentru FID recomanda un scor mai mic de 100 milisecunde.
Intre 100 ms si 300 ms, site-ul va avea nevoie de imbunatatiri pentru a respecta noile standarde impuse de Google.
CLS (cumulative layout shift) – masoara stabilitatea vizuala si frecventa cu care utilizatorii experimenteaza modificari neasteptate ale aspectului vizual al paginilor din site.
Google considera ca o schimbare vizuala are loc de fiecare data cand un element dintr-o pagina web isi schimba pozitia in mod neasteptat.
Aici este partea cea mai grea din Core Web Vitals, deoarece, conform Google, site-urile trebuie sa obtina un scor de 0.1 pentru a respecta noile standare.
Google si experienta utilizatorilor
Google isi propune sa ofere cea mai buna experienta posibila utilizatorilor motorului sau de cautare, iar pentru a face acest lucru, inevitabil trebuie sa-i oblige pe proprietarii de site-uri sa respecte „cele mai bune” practici.
S-ar putea sa-ti placa sau nu, dar Google modeleaza internetul, si daca maine Google sugereaza ca toate site-urile ar trebui sa se incarce in X secunde atunci cand sunt accesate de pe dispozitivele mobile cu conexiune 3G, toate site-urile vor fi nevoite sa se adapteze.
Ce este experienta pe pagina in viziunea Google?
Experienta paginii reprezinta un set de semnale masurate de Google pentru a vedea daca paginile unui site ofera o experienta buna atunci cand un utilizator viziteaza site-ul respectiv.
Toate semnalele urmatoare sunt luate in considerare de Google pentru a masura o „experienta de pagina buna” in rezultatele organice:
- Mobile friendliness: pagini optimizate pentru navigarea pe dispozitivele mobile.
- Safe-browsing: paginile site-ului nu gazduiesc continut rau intentionat (malware) sau inselator (phishing).
- HTTPS security: paginile site-ului sunt servite vizitatorilor in varianta securizata cu certificat SSL.
- Core Web Vitals: paginile site-ului ofera o experienta excelenta utilizatorilor, cu accent pe aspecte precum: viteza de incarcare, interactivitate si stabilitate vizuala.
Daca primii trei parametri iti pot suna deja cunoscut, pentru ca reprezinta deja conditii pentru optimizarea eficienta a site-ului in Google, Core Web Vitals este anuntat a fi urmatorul pas pe care Google planuieste sa-l introduca in procesul de optimizare SEO, pentru a defini experienta de navigare oferita de paginile unui site utilizatorilor.
Care este impactul provocat de Core Web Vitals in SEO?
In primul rand, Google inca nu foloseste Core Web Vitals in algoritmii motorului de cautare.
Toate semnalele prezentate anterior vor deveni un factor oficial de ranking (clasare) a rezultatelor organice din luna Mai 2021 si se vor aplica momentan doar cautarilor realizate pe dispozitivele mobile.
Google va continua sa puna accent pe continutul cel mai relevant in topul rezultatelor organice, indicand chiar si faptul ca paginile care ofera cele mai bune informatii vor ocupa pozitii mai bune, chiar daca au unele probleme cu metricele analizate de Core Web Vitals.
Deocamadata, calitatea continutului si numarul de backlink-uri au prioritate in ceea ce priveste experienta unui utilizator pe o pagina dintr-un site.
Cu toate acestea, in cazurile in care paginile sunt similare din punct de vedere al relevantei continutului, Google va afisa intai paginile cu cea mai buna experienta.
Asta inseamna ca Google va oferi timp tuturor site-urilor pentru a respecta noile standarde de SEO si web development, urmand ca in viitor Core Web Vitals sa capete o importanta tot mai mare.
Instrumente de masurare a metricelor Core Web Vitals si experienta paginii:
Nu stii sigur daca site-ul tau respecta noile standarde impuse de Google? Nicio problema. In piata exista suficiente instrumente dedicate de analiza, precum:
- Mobile Friendly Test
- Page speed insight
- Safe-browsing
- HTTPS: Deschide site-ul sau o pagina din site cu browserul Google Chrome si, daca vezi un lacat langa adresa URL, inseamna ca site-ul este in HTTPS.
In ceea ce priveste metricele Core Web Vitals, poti utiliza urmatoare instrumente pentru o analiza si recomandari detaliate de remediere a problemelor intampinate de site:
Si sa nu uitam ca performantele site-urilor din punct de vedere Core Web Vital sunt prezente si in Search Console:
Cum pot imbunatati valoarea metricilor Core Web Vitals?
Pentru a imbunatati valorile metricilor Core Web Vitals, este necesar sa adopti o serie de practici tehnice care sa optimizeze performanta site-ului tau. Fiecare dintre cei trei indicatori principali (LCP, FID/INP si CLS) necesita atentie si strategii specifice. Iata cum poti aborda fiecare dintre acesti metrici pentru a oferi o experienta mai buna utilizatorilor si a imbunatati pozitionarea in motoarele de cautare.
1. Imbunatatirea LCP (Largest Contentful Paint)
LCP masoara cat de rapid este incarcat si afisat cel mai mare element de pe pagina ta. Pentru a optimiza LCP, exista mai multe tehnici esentiale:
- Optimizarea imaginilor: Imaginile sunt deseori cel mai mare element de pe o pagina, asa ca este crucial sa folosesti formate moderne si eficiente, cum ar fi WebP, care ofera o compresie superioara fara a pierde din calitatea vizuala. In plus, utilizeaza tehnici de „lazy loading” pentru a incarca imaginile doar atunci cand sunt necesare (adica atunci cand devin vizibile pentru utilizator), reducand astfel timpul de incarcare initial.
- Caching eficient: Implementarea unui sistem eficient de cache, fie pe partea serverului, fie prin folosirea unui CDN (Content Delivery Network), poate reduce semnificativ timpul necesar pentru incarcarea resurselor statice. Un CDN va distribui continutul tau printr-o retea globala de servere, asigurand o livrare rapida utilizatorilor, indiferent de locatia lor geografica.
- Minimizarea resurselor care blocheaza incarcarea: Elementele precum CSS si JavaScript pot incetini procesul de randare a paginii. Este important sa minimizezi si sa compactezi aceste fisiere, eliminand codul inutil si folosind tehnici de optimizare, cum ar fi „async” sau „defer” pentru scripturi, astfel incat acestea sa nu blocheze incarcarea paginii principale.
2. Reducerea FID (First Input Delay) si INP (Interaction to Next Paint)
FID masoara timpul de raspuns la prima interactiune a utilizatorului, iar INP, un metric mai nou, va evalua timpul total de raspuns la interactiuni. Reducerea acestor valori implica optimizarea codului de interactiune, in special cel JavaScript:
- Optimizarea si curatarea codului JavaScript: JavaScript-ul poate fi responsabil pentru intarzieri in interactiunile utilizatorului. Verifica si elimina scripturile care nu sunt necesare sau care nu aduc valoare imediata utilizatorului. In plus, foloseste tehnici precum „code splitting” pentru a incarca doar scripturile necesare in anumite sectiuni ale paginii.
- Implementarea „lazy loading” pentru resurse necritice: Asigura-te ca resursele care nu sunt imediat necesare, cum ar fi imagini sau sectiuni de continut de mai jos in pagina, sunt incarcate doar atunci cand utilizatorul le vizualizeaza. Acest lucru nu doar ca imbunatateste viteza de incarcare initiala, dar si reduce blocajele in timpul interactiunilor.
- Reducerea interactiunilor blocante: Interactiunile blocante apar atunci cand un script necesita prea mult timp pentru a raspunde unei actiuni a utilizatorului, cum ar fi un click sau o tastare. Este important sa eviti procesele intensive de calcul la interactiunea cu utilizatorul si sa imparti aceste sarcini in bucati mai mici, care pot fi procesate rapid.
3. Reducerea CLS (Cumulative Layout Shift)
CLS se refera la stabilitatea vizuala a paginii si masoara cat de mult se misca elementele in timpul incarcarii. Un CLS ridicat poate duce la o experienta frustranta pentru utilizator, asa ca reducerea acestuia este esentiala:
- Stabileste dimensiunile elementelor vizuale: Una dintre cele mai comune cauze ale unui CLS mare este lipsa definirii dimensiunilor pentru imagini, videoclipuri si alte elemente media. Asigura-te ca toate aceste elemente au dimensiuni specificate in codul HTML, astfel incat browserul sa rezerve spatiul necesar inca din start, prevenind miscarea brusca a elementelor in timpul incarcarii.
- Evita insertiile tardive de continut: Continutul dinamic, cum ar fi reclamele sau pop-up-urile, poate fi adaugat tardiv, cauzand deplasari neplacute in layout. Este important sa rezervezi spatiu pentru aceste elemente in timpul initial al incarcarii sau sa le incarci intr-o maniera care sa nu influenteze structura paginii.
- Optimizeaza fonturile si folosirea de third-party scripts: Fonturile personalizate pot provoca schimbari in layout-ul paginii daca nu sunt optimizate corect. Asigura-te ca folosesti tehnici precum „font-display: swap” pentru a evita schimbarile brusce de font. De asemenea, minimizeaza utilizarea scripturilor terte care pot provoca schimbari vizuale sau intarzierea randarii.
Insa, imbunatatirea experientei utilizatorilor pe o pagina dintr-un site este un subiect destul de complex si necesita cunostiinte tehnice pentru a obtine rezultatele impuse de Google prin metricele Core Web Vitals. Asadar poti apela la o agentie SEO care te poate ajuta sa optimizezi site-ul din punct de vedere al vitezei de incarcare.
Retine ca Google se va concentra din ce in ce mai mult pe experienta utilizatorilor si pe termen lung, acesti factori de ranking vor capata o importanta mult mai mare in SEO.